How to Establish a Traceability Data Framework

A recent recall of Hydrolyzed Vegetable Protein (HVP) has once again reinforced the harmful effects of a disconnected supply chain.  HVP is an ingredient found in many spices, sauces, and mixes, products which are themselves used in millions of foods.  Recalls such as these can severely affect consumer brand confidence.   Because of the broken chains in our traceability system, many more brands are affected because most food manufacturers cannot see where all of the contaminated products have come from upstream nor can they see what products have been affected downstream.  There are things that can be done today, however, to enable clearer visibility along the supply chain and to help you get ready for a future National Traceability System, as proposed by the U.S. Congress.  As a provider of traceability services, Afilias has some best practice recommendations for you for establishing a framework to help you view your product data from farm to fork.

Senate Makes Progress: Afilias Commends HELP Committee for Its Renewed Focus on Food Safety Reform

Hearing explores reform of U.S. food safety system; sets stage for Senate action this year

WASHINGTON – October 22, 2009 – The Senate Health, Education, Labor and Pensions (HELP) Committee today held a hearing to discuss S. 510, the FDA Food Safety Modernization Act and specific proposals for food safety reforms. Second Chance for Reform: Afilias Welcomes House Passage of Critical Food Safety Legislation

H.R. 2749 to create a national tracing system for food from ‘farm to fork’

Washington, D.C. – On a second attempt at passage, the U.S. House successfully voted in favor of legislation to reform a food safety system that has been battered by a lack of consumer confidence and numerous food recalls over the past few years.
